Silhouette

...And the Gull extended its Wings
Acclimate for Flight
Effortless as the Air one breathes
The Wind swept beneath her Feathers



Raising her up, weightless
Cast against the Sun in Silhouette
A Shadow of Elegance

BLANKET

As the Bay merges with the great Sea
My bare toes sink into her Sands
Swept away into the Sunlight
Eyes squinting through weak Sunglasses

The tide threatens to reach my blanket
I freeze as one often does
Hoping she doesn't reach my belongings and I
Nonetheless, the outcome is the same... nervous laughter
With relief I'm spared
Noticing others were not
But it's her warning if I selectly remain
We ante up, she wears a charming poker face
I withdraw only somewhat, allowing myself to tarry near her Shore

Children rolling off the lifeguard's sandhills
Collecting Sand Crabs in their Pails..
Creating a barrier to defer the waters

Deflected I am, by the glorious Sun and happy People
She must've noticed my guard had been lowered
As the Shark stalks his prey
Briskly, she swept across me, and soused my blanket

I fold...
